Home
last modified time | relevance | path

Searched refs:NarrowMask (Results 1 – 1 of 1) sorted by relevance

/llvm-project-15.0.7/llvm/unittests/Analysis/
H A DVectorUtilsTest.cpp115 SmallVector<int, 16> NarrowMask; in TEST_F() local
122 narrowShuffleMaskElts(1, makeArrayRef(WideMask), NarrowMask); in TEST_F()
123 EXPECT_EQ(makeArrayRef(NarrowMask), makeArrayRef({3,2,0,-1})); in TEST_F()
136 narrowShuffleMaskElts(3, makeArrayRef(WideMask), NarrowMask); in TEST_F()
137 EXPECT_EQ(makeArrayRef(NarrowMask), makeArrayRef({0,1,2})); in TEST_F()
144 narrowShuffleMaskElts(4, makeArrayRef(WideMask), NarrowMask); in TEST_F()
145 EXPECT_EQ(makeArrayRef(NarrowMask), makeArrayRef({12,13,14,15,8,9,10,11,0,1,2,3,-1,-1,-1,-1})); in TEST_F()
155 narrowShuffleMaskElts(3, makeArrayRef(WideMask), NarrowMask); in TEST_F()
156 EXPECT_EQ(makeArrayRef(NarrowMask), makeArrayRef({6,7,8,0,1,2,-1,-1,-1})); in TEST_F()